Understanding Bone Density and Its Importance
Bone density refers to the amount of bone mineral in bone tissue, indicating the strength and health of your bones.
It’s a crucial factor in determining the risk of fractures and osteoporosis, especially as you age.
Maintaining healthy bone density can aid in preventing bone-related diseases, enhancing mobility, and ensuring overall well-being.
Traditionally, bone density is measured using Dual-Energy X-ray Absorptiometry (DEXA).
This method is highly accurate and widely used in clinical settings.
However, accessing DEXA machines can be expensive and inconvenient for many individuals.
This led to the development of bone density scanners with alternative technologies, such as ultrasound.
The Innovation of Ultrasound Quantitative Mode
Ultrasound technology is increasingly being integrated into bone density scanners for at-home use.
Unlike X-rays, ultrasound does not expose the user to radiation, making it a safer alternative.
The ultrasound quantitative mode in bone density scanners enables users to assess bone health quickly and accurately from the comfort of their homes.
This mode uses sound waves to evaluate bone properties, providing a detailed analysis of bone quality.
It measures factors such as bone mass and elasticity, which are critical in assessing the risk of fractures.
Because of its portability and ease of use, ultrasound bone density scanners are becoming an attractive option for home assessments.
Advantages of At-Home Bone Density Assessment
Convenience and Accessibility
One of the most significant advantages of at-home bone density scanners is their accessibility.
You can perform assessments at any time without the need to schedule appointments or travel to a medical facility.
This convenience allows for more frequent monitoring of bone health, particularly beneficial for individuals with limited mobility or those residing in remote areas.
Cost-Effectiveness
Frequent visits to clinics for DEXA scans can be costly over time.
At-home bone density scanners provide a more affordable alternative.
Once you invest in a device, you can perform unlimited assessments without additional costs.
This long-term cost-saving potential makes these devices an economical choice for maintaining bone health.
Non-Invasive and Radiation-Free
Unlike DEXA, at-home ultrasound bone density scanners are non-invasive and do not rely on ionizing radiation.
This makes them safer for repeated use, an essential factor for individuals monitoring their bone health over long periods.
How to Use Ultrasound Bone Density Scanners
Using an ultrasound bone density scanner is generally straightforward.
Most devices are accompanied by a user-friendly interface and detailed instructions.
Here’s a basic guide on how to use one:
Step 1: Setting Up the Device
First, ensure that your device is fully charged and ready for use.
Refer to the user manual for specific instructions on powering and calibrating the device.
Step 2: Preparing for the Scan
To get an accurate reading, position the device on the specified area of your body.
Common sites include the heel or the wrist, as these areas are indicative of overall bone density.
Step 3: Performing the Scan
Follow the on-screen prompts if your device has a digital display.
The scanner will emit sound waves into your body, which bounce back and are measured by the device.
Step 4: Analyzing the Results
Once the scan is complete, review the results displayed on the device.
Many scanners offer insights into your bone density score, providing a comparison to age and gender norms.
